Disciplinary procedure.
Except as provided in ORS 677.202 or 677.205 (1)(a), any proceeding for
disciplinary action of a licensee licensed under this chapter shall be
substantially in accord with the following procedure:
(1) A written
complaint of some person, not excluding members or employees of the Oregon
Medical Board, shall be verified and filed with the board.
(2) A hearing
shall be given to the accused in accordance with ORS chapter 183 as a contested
case. [Amended by 1957 c.681 §6; 1961 c.400 §6; 1967 c.470 §31; 1971 c.734 §118;
1983 c.486 §23; 1989 c.830 §11]
